Coal production: Hard coal (thousand metric tons) - Malaysia - Yearly - UN
This series is part of the dataset: Coal production by country and quality (UN)
Download Full Dataset (.xlsx)Latest updates. In Malaysia, the production of hard coal was 3,331.19 thousand metric tons in 2024, compared to 3,169.13 in 2023. This represents a gain of 5.11 percent.
Sample. There are 35 data points in the yearly time series displayed in the graph above. The series covers the time span extending from December 1990 to December 2024.
History. Here are some statistics computed on the full sample: production reached a trough of 80.00 thousand metric tons in 1992; it reached its maximum of 3,459.18 in 2019; it had an average value of 1,524.51.
Latest values
| Date | Value - Thousand metric tons |
|---|---|
| 2022-12-31 | 3227.582 |
| 2023-12-31 | 3169.128 |
| 2024-12-31 | 3331.192 |
